Logic Gate
提供:Terraria Japan Wiki
この項目は情報が不十分、もしくは古いバージョンの情報のままです。 加筆、訂正などをしてくださる協力者を求めています。 |
Logic Gate 論理ゲート | |
---|---|
情報 | |
タイプ | メカニズム |
設置 | 可能 |
大きさ | 幅1 x 高さ1 |
最大所持数 | 999 |
レアリティ | |
購入/売却 | 2 / 40 |
調査 | 5 |
Item ID : 3603 - 3608 |
アイテム > メカニズム
Steampunkerから購入できるメカニズムアイテム。
「Logic Gate」と「Logic Gate Lamp」を組み合わせて使うことで、複雑な論理演算ができるようになる。
目次 |
[編集] 種類
[編集] Logic Gate
演算の「出力部」に相当するメカニズム。
これ単体では動作せず、後述の「Logic Gate Lamp」を1つ以上、Logic Gateの上に積むようにして配置する必要がある。
Logic Gateは点灯・消灯が切り替わった時にそれぞれ信号を送る。「点灯した時だけ」ではない。
[編集] Logic Gate Lamp
Logic Gate Lamp | |
---|---|
情報 | |
タイプ | メカニズム |
設置 | 可能 |
大きさ | 幅1 x 高さ1 |
最大所持数 | 999 |
レアリティ | |
購入/売却 | 10 / 2 (On,Off) 2 / 40 (Faulty) |
調査 | 5 |
Item ID : 3602,3618,3663 |
演算の「入力部」に相当するメカニズム。
Lampと名が付くが光源としての役割はなく、Logic Gateへの入力でしか役目はない。
Logic Gate Lampに信号が入力されると、ON・/OFFが切り替わる。
[編集] Logic Gate Lamp (Faulty)
これが積まれたLogic Gateは青色に変化し、以下のような振る舞いをするようになる。
- 積まれているLogic Gate LampのON/OFF状態が変化しても、信号を出力しなくなる。
- 1つ以上のLogic Gate Lampが積まれているLogic GateのFaulty Lampに信号が入力された時、(の数)÷(の数+の数) の確率で信号を出力する。
Lamp (Faulty)の使い方
Logic Gateの上にとをいくつか載せ、更にその上にを載せ、このに信号を送ることでLogic Gateからランダムな信号の送信を行う。
この際、が繋がったLogic Gateは青色に変わり、理論演算機能は無視される。
の下に連続するとの比率によりそののランダムの発生率が決まる。
すなわち×1なら100%常に切り替わり、×1と×1なら50%で切り替わる。
これらを利用してif演算に使用することも可能である。
ちなみに×0なら常に切り替わらない。
[編集] 使い方
Logic Gateの上辺にLampを直接積み上げるように設置することで、入力に応じて論理演算処理をする。
Lampがワイヤーから信号を受け取り、Logic Gateは上のLampの状態が条件に当てはまっていれば本体に接続されているワイヤーに出力を送信する。
LampのOnとOffはオセロの白と黒のようなもので、本質的には同じアイテムである。OnとOffはワイヤーから信号送られる入力の度に逆転する。
[編集] Tips
一般的な2入力だけでなく、1入力や3以上の入力も可能である。NOTゲート(全てOff)はないが、Lamp(On)で代用可能。
1入力のGateは複数色のワイヤーをひとつにまとめたり、ダイオードとして使用したりすることができる。
本来Terrariaのワイヤー信号にはTRUEとFALSE(OnとOff)の概念はないため、複数入力がある場合レバータイプのスイッチであってもレバーの位置がいつも同じ時にOnになるとは限らない。
何もない空間にいきなり置くことができるので、建築を始める際の起点として利用できる。
[編集] 参考 真理値表-論理積(AND)
入力A | 入力B | → | 出力Y |
---|---|---|---|
On | On | On | |
On | Off | Off | |
Off | On | Off | |
Off | Off | Off |
論理積の数式はY=A・B
AとBを入力、Yを出力とする。
入力同士を掛け合わせた積が出力となる。どんな数に0を掛けても積は0になる=入力に一つでも0(偽)が含まれれば、出力は必ず0(偽)となる。
言葉で説明するならば、入力が2つどちらも「真」の時、出力は「真」になり、逆に一つでも入力に「偽」があれば出力は「偽」になる。
これらは入力が三つ以上又は一つの場合にも説明ができる。
[編集] 参考 真理値表-否定論理積(NAND)
入力A | 入力B | → | 出力Y |
---|---|---|---|
On | On | Off | |
On | Off | On | |
Off | On | On | |
Off | Off | On |